I don't have time for reading the whole thread or making any important contributions myself, but I have a few comments to the paragraph quoted above. First of all, I am by no means a search expert. My main reason for using MTD in Gothmog was not a belief that it was theoretically superior to other alpha-beta variants, but rather that it is by far the cleanest and easiest to implement. My main reason for switching to PVS in Glaurung was not that I was not satisfied with the performance of MTD, but rather that I wanted to try something new in order to learn more about search techniques. For weak engines like mine, the choice between MTD or PVS isn't really that important anyway. With so many other more fundamental weaknesses to fix, there simply isn't any major gain to be found by changing the main search algorithm (except broadening your knowledge and experience, which can be important in the long run).
